How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sherman Oaks?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| New Sherman Oaks Studio Apartments | $1,846 | $1,350 | $3,041 |
| New Sherman Oaks 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,551 | $1,000 | $4,536 |
| New Sherman Oaks 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,606 | $1,925 | $10,000+ |
| New Sherman Oaks 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,519 | $2,350 | $5,999 |
| New Sherman Oaks 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,466 | $3,800 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about New Sherman Oaks Apartments
What is the Cheapest New apartment in Sherman Oaks?
Currently the most affordable New Apartment in Sherman Oaks is at Casa De Milagro listed at $1,697.
How much is the average rent for a New Sherman Oaks Apartment?
The average rent for a New Apartment in Sherman Oaks is $2,967.
What is the largest New Sherman Oaks Apartment for rent?
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Sherman Oaks is a 2,079 square feet unit starting from $2,850 at The Residences at 5020.
What is the average size for Sherman Oaks New Apartments for rent?
The average size for a New rental in Sherman Oaks is currently at 767 sq ft.
